Moving Forward
I'm not the best when it comes to wording my thoughts, so I'll just put down what's on my mind. Vivian was one of a kind, someone that you could put your trust and faith into, ask her for any favor and she wouldn't expect anything in return. She was there through some of my darkest times and best moments, no matter what situation I found myself in, Vivian always kept a positive attitude and found a way to cheer me up.
I want to share my summed up perspective on how I met Vivian and our relationship over the past year. (If you aren't interested, the future plans are down below)
In October of 2018, a friend of mine told me that he knew Vivian and that she wanted to come back to the community after her 3-4 year hiatus but wasn't sure how. I recommended patreon (I believe Tein Fuon jiu Tempuru convinced her to join PA) and said that I'd love to help her out if possible. Fast forward to December of 2018 and I get the news that Vivian had created her Patreon account, I immediately join and started messaging her. Within a matter of hours we became great friends, we talked for days on end. I'll never forget the amount of trust and faith she had in me, so much that she gave me her login details within the first 3 days of meeting her without me asking for them. We started talking about our life experiences, families, future plans, goals, and so much more for countless hours. February of 2019 our friend group named "V-Force" was created, this group consisted of Vivian, me (Reol), Yukio, and Sotanath. Our group would work together to translate Vivian's work, and 1-3 times a month, we would all hop into a video chat and talk about anything that came to mind. Vivian would draw up hilarious pictures to go with our conversations. Around March of 2019, Vivian was hospitalized due to overworking herself, she had told me that she was exhausted of working for her boss and was finding it difficult to continue with both her job and Patreon. She said that she wanted to start her own company, since she had the skills, talent, and connections to easily run her own, but was worried it wouldn't work out. After a few weeks of talking with me and her other friends & family, she quit her job and started her own company. Things were only going up from here, her company was getting constant work to do, she was meeting her quotas, she had plans of expanding her work overseas, and most importantly to her, she had time to enjoy her hobby of drawing size art. Fast forward a few months, I recommended Vivian to create some artwork for her patreon, something to add a little "pzazz" to it. Without any of us asking, Vivian had created a banner and tier images with images of the V-force group in it, we were shocked and blown away. We asked why she had included us in it since it was suppose to be for her patreon, and she mentioned that our friendship was more important to her than the typical/basic PA artwork. It was moments like this that made me realize how much of a humble and kind person Vivian was. Coming up on November of 2019, things started going downhill. Vivian's father was hospitalized, requiring her to step away from the community and her company. Her company started to take some damage without her being there. A week after Vivian's father recovered and Vivian was back at work, the Corona Virus became a major issue in China. Vivian and all of her staff were stuck working from home while the company took more damage. After staying at home for 10+ days, she found out that she caught the virus and immediately becomes hospitalized. At first Vivian messaged me saying she was doing okay and felt weak. Even in a bad situation like this, she would still jokingly message me that she might not make it and laugh it off saying to not worry about it. The last message I sent her was "Bye! Hope to hear from you again soon", it still brings me great pain that I wasn't able to give her a proper goodbye and thank her for everything that she's done, but I know that she already knew how thankful I was of her. Vivian went into a coma for a day and woke up again, one last time to talk to her husband. Before she passed, one of the things she mentioned was "Please thank Reol and my friends for their support and encouragement". There were so many mixed emotions once I heard this, Anger, Sadness, Happiness, confusion, over the course of one week all of this happened, even in her final moments her heart and thoughts were still with the community. Her full and true final words to her husband were "Don't be afraid, I will continue to live well". February 17th of 2020, at 3:00PM CST, Vivian left behind her husband, her son, her family, and the community. Our thoughts and prayers will always be out there for her and her family members.
Vivian wouldn't want us to be grieving over her death, she'd want us to celebrate her life and to enjoy & remember her through what she loved doing the most, drawing size content for the community.
Future Plans
NOTE - Not everything mentioned here is set in stone, these are just plans that could change at any time
After some discussions with Vivian's husband (Helix), there were a few conclusions we came down to.
The first one being that we didn't want to let Vivian's legacy and passion for the community die here, we wanted to continue it as that's what she would've wanted. Helix plans on attempting to continue her art with her art-style. Of course this isn't a simple task and is a very touchy subject for someone that was so close to Vivian, so please be mindful and respect his decision and what happens from here on out.
The second conclusion we came down to was that Helix didn't want to accept donations, Vivian always wanted to work for her money and wouldn't have wanted to accept donations. Instead, we will be keeping the patreon up and anyone who'd like to support her family can join with any amount they'd like. We currently have it set to not bill every month and to only bill you the first time you join, if that does happen to change in the future there will be an announcement for it.
There was the last plan that I wanted to announce, but out of respect for Helix and Vivian's family, I want to give them a lot of time to think about it before announcing it to the community.
